Escape artist Joseph Burrus, who was desperate to emulate his hero, Houdini, died on Halloween 1990 while trying to perform a ‘Buried Alive’ trick. Joseph, 32, was lying inside a see-through casket when he was lowered into a hole in the ground.

How does the guillotine magic trick work?

The traditional Guillotine illusion Unlike the traditional guillotine used for executions, the narrow blade does not have the large weight mounted above it. When the blade is released, it falls through the stock and emerges completely from the bottom, having apparently passed completely through the “victim’s” neck.

How does clearly impossible work?

Clearly Impossible is a variation of the Sawing a Woman in Half illusion devised by magician Jonathan Pendragon. Unlike most other versions of the illusion, it uses clear-sided boxes that allow the assistant to be seen throughout the performance.
